1. Professional Plastering Trowels

A plastering trowel is one of the most important tools in any plasterer's kit. Whether you're applying a base coat or polishing a final skim, a quality trowel provides the control needed to achieve a smooth, even finish.

When choosing a trowel, look for features such as:

  • Stainless steel blades for durability
  • Comfortable ergonomic handles
  • Lightweight construction to reduce fatigue
  • Flexible blades for easier finishing

2. Finishing Blades And Spatulas

Large finishing blades have become increasingly popular for modern plastering projects. They're ideal for covering larger areas quickly while producing a flatter, more consistent finish.

Professional finishing blades are commonly used for:

  • Skimming plasterboard
  • Applying finishing plaster
  • Jointing compounds
  • Thin-coat plaster systems

3. Mixing Equipment

Consistent material preparation is essential for professional results. Specialist mixing paddles and mixing drills ensure plaster is blended evenly before application, helping to eliminate lumps and improve workability.

The benefits include:

  1. Faster material preparation
  2. Improved plaster consistency
  3. Reduced waste
  4. Easier application

4. Surface Preparation Tools

Preparation is often overlooked, but it's one of the most important stages of any plastering project. Properly preparing the surface improves adhesion and creates the ideal base for plaster or render.

Essential preparation tools include:

  • Scrapers
  • Scarifiers
  • Sponge floats
  • Cleaning brushes

Taking the time to prepare surfaces correctly helps reduce the risk of defects and contributes to a longer-lasting finish.

5. Floats And Finishing Accessories

Different stages of plastering and rendering require different finishing tools. Specialist floats allow you to achieve the desired finish depending on the material and application.

Common options include:

  • Sponge floats
  • Plastic floats
  • Rubber floats
  • Finishing floats

Having a selection of finishing accessories means you're prepared for a wide range of plastering and rendering projects.
